Don't really understand the thinking with Petracca. For one you're wasting a bench spot that could me making you cash and secondly you won't be able to use him as a downgrade when it gets to trading season in rnds 6-12. Maybe you want to use him for loopholing but that's not the easiest thing to get right and you'll generally have a player out injured most weeks anyway.
